What is the difference among isolation transformers and step up or step down transformer?
Actually an isolation transformer may be physically the similar as a Step up/Step Down transformer. The main difference is in the way they are used.
Another difference is that in a normal transformer there will be capacitance among the 2 windings, between the windings and core, among the core and shell, etc.
These capacitances bring in high frequency noise from outside, which will be transmitted in the secondary circuit. So [in an isolation transformer] wires are connected among each component, (not direct contact, but with insulation present). This allows a leakage current and eliminates unnecessary capacitance.
Stefan-Boltzmann constant; sigma (Stefan, L. Boltzmann) The constant of proportionality exist in the Stefan-Boltzmann law. It is equivalent to 5.6697 x 10 -8 W/m 2 /K 4 .
